The Office of Financial Reporting (OFR) is responsible for accurate financial reporting for the State by providing oversight and assistance to state agencies. OFR primary responsibilities include:

  • Prepare the State of Mississippi's Comprehensive Annual Financial Report (ACFR).
  • Assist state agencies in matters concerning Ggovernmental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P), including preparation of all state agencies’ financial statements (GAAP packets).
  • Collect federal grant information for inclusion in the Single Audit.
  • Prepare the Annual Report of Budgetary Basis Expenditures, a supplement to the ACFR.
